Transaction 2770504686e3c681506a622e38f20cb1a8e70831e370bc54b911822a377dfde8
1 Input
1 Output
-
2770504686e3c681506a622e38f20cb1a8e70831e370bc54b911822a377dfde8:0
- value
- 857883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b26a51d82a5c17706806d7c7ad2e4ec69af2b2e OP_EQUAL
- address
- 375n5xktYBcmrwiqpVoz3gGH92XKXBea3q